Rotational Grazing and Wildlife Management

Rotational grazing is a livestock management practice that can significantly benefit wildlife management. This method involves moving livestock between different pastures or grazing areas on a planned schedule to prevent overgrazing and allow vegetation recovery. Agriculture Basics: What is Dryland Farming?

Dryland farming in Washington State is a crucial agricultural practice, especially in the semi-arid regions of Eastern Washington. This method relies on minimal rainfall, typically without the use of irrigation, making it well-suited for areas like the Palouse and the Columbia Plateau. Agriculture Basics: The Farm Bill

what is the farm bill

The Farm Bill, a cornerstone of U.S. agricultural policy, has a rich history dating back to the Great Depression. Initially introduced in the 1930s as a response to the economic challenges faced by farmers during that time, the Farm Bill aimed to provide financial stability and ensure a steady food supply for the nation.
